Statistics Behind Virtual Tennis' Growing Popularity

Virtual tennis, a fusion of technology and sport, has seen a remarkable growth trajectory. According to a report by the Virtual Sports Federation, participation in virtual tennis increased by 75% in the last two years, showcasing its rising popularity. The appeal of virtual tennis lies in its accessibility; a study by the Global Sports Technology Association found that 90% of virtual tennis players live in urban areas with limited access to real tennis facilities.

Technological Innovations Transforming Virtual Tennis

The technology behind virtual tennis is evolving rapidly. A recent study published in the "Journal of Sports Technology" highlighted that modern VR equipment can now simulate 98% accuracy in ball physics and player movements. This advancement not only enhances the gaming experience but also helps professional players to train more effectively.

Virtual Tennis Tournaments: A New eSports Phenomenon

The world of virtual tennis is not just limited to casual play. The International Virtual Tennis Federation reports that over 500 virtual tournaments were held last year, with players from over 40 countries participating. These tournaments are not only a testament to the game's global reach but also contribute to the growth of eSports, which, according to Newzoo's Global eSports Market Report, is projected to reach a $1.5 billion valuation by 2025.

The Synergy of Virtual and Traditional Tennis

Does virtual tennis pose a threat to traditional tennis? Experts say no. A survey by the World Tennis Association revealed that 60% of virtual tennis players showed increased interest in watching and playing real-world tennis, indicating a symbiotic relationship between the two.
